Advantage Lancaster

  • The Financial Times' 2007 Top 40 European Masters in Management programmes ranked Lancaster's MSc in Management 18th in Europe and 4th in the UK. LUMS rose eight places, the highest mover in the Top 40
  • Lancaster University was ranked 10th nationally and first in the north west in the Independent Good University Guide for 2009.
  • Ranked 5th for Business & Management Studies by Guardian University Guide 09
